Компьютерное моделирование систем. Князев В.Н - 17 стр.

UptoLike

17
Обслуживание заявок в СРВ на основе дисциплины обслуживания с
абсолютными приоритетами организуется в соответствии с рис.3.2. Заяв-
кам типа z
1
, z
2
, ... , z
m
присвоены абсолютные приоритеты соответственно
в порядке их уменьшения. Отличие данной дисциплины обслуживания от
дисциплины обслуживания с относительными приоритетами заключается в
том, что если при обслуживании выбранной заявки z
i
поступает заявка с
более высоким приоритетом, то обслуживание заявки z
i
прерывается и она
заносится в начало очереди O
i
, а "Диспетчер" переключает процессор на
обслуживание поступившей заявки с более высоким приоритетом. Пре-
рванная заявка ожидает в своей очереди дообслуживания.
Рис. 3.2 Zi
Рассматривается случай поступления в систему двух входящих про-
стейших потоков заявок: высокоприоритетного потока заявок типа z
1
и
низкоприоритетного потока заявок типа z
2
- со средними интервалами со-
ответственно T
1
и T
2
.
Характеристики качества функционирования СРВ, приведенные в
описании лабораторной работы № 2 данного пособия, для случая двух
входящих потоков определяются следующим образом.
Суммарная загрузка процессора равна:
R =
1
+
2
=
1
/ T
1
+
2
/ T
2
,
где
1
и
2
- средняя длительность обслуживания заявок соответст-
венно высокоприоритетного и низкоприоритетного потоков.
Длительность обслуживания имеет экспоненциальное распределе-
ние.
      Обслуживание заявок в СРВ на основе дисциплины обслуживания с
абсолютными приоритетами организуется в соответствии с рис.3.2. Заяв-
кам типа z1 , z2, ... , zm присвоены абсолютные приоритеты соответственно
в порядке их уменьшения. Отличие данной дисциплины обслуживания от
дисциплины обслуживания с относительными приоритетами заключается в
том, что если при обслуживании выбранной заявки zi поступает заявка с
более высоким приоритетом, то обслуживание заявки zi прерывается и она
заносится в начало очереди Oi, а "Диспетчер" переключает процессор на
обслуживание поступившей заявки с более высоким приоритетом. Пре-
рванная заявка ожидает в своей очереди дообслуживания.




       …


      …




                        Рис. 3.2                   Zi

      Рассматривается случай поступления в систему двух входящих про-
стейших потоков заявок: высокоприоритетного потока заявок типа z1 и
низкоприоритетного потока заявок типа z2 - со средними интервалами со-
ответственно T1 и T2.
      Характеристики качества функционирования СРВ, приведенные в
описании лабораторной работы № 2 данного пособия, для случая двух
входящих потоков определяются следующим образом.
      Суммарная загрузка процессора равна:
        R = 1 + 2 = 1 / T1 + 2 / T2,
      где 1 и 2 - средняя длительность обслуживания заявок соответст-
венно высокоприоритетного и низкоприоритетного потоков.
     Длительность обслуживания имеет экспоненциальное распределе-
ние.




                                   17